== English == === Etymology === Probably a habitational surname from Shaw Cross, a suburb of Dewsbury, a town in West Yorkshire, from Old English sċeaga (“copse, thicket”) + croft (“enclosed field”). === Proper noun === Shawcross (plural Shawcrosses) A surname from Old English. ==== Statistics ==== According to the 2010 United States Census, Shawcross is the 84748th most common surname in the United States, belonging to 221 individuals. Shawcross is most common among White (97.29%) individuals. === Further reading === Hanks, Patrick, editor (2003), “Shawcross”, in Dictionary of American Family Names, volume 3, New York: Oxford University Press, →ISBN.
